Output 79192248a2827c5467954459f63d494e90eedf00b5d560a9a7c3ae5050194697:0

value
26008259
script pubkey
OP_HASH160 OP_PUSHBYTES_20 658e6b51c947c0d594003181c05a98a97cf8ecab OP_EQUAL
address
MHA96GN87yR1S3WdvFg9ykZzVev35SyvZ7
transaction
79192248a2827c5467954459f63d494e90eedf00b5d560a9a7c3ae5050194697
spent
true